Simulation Based Acquisition for the Artemis Program

Abstract

This briefing describes simulation-based acquisition (SBA) for the Artemis System, an active standoff chemical warfare (CW) detection system for near-real time identification of CW agent vapors and aerosols. This system is design to give the war fighter maximum warning and battlefield awareness, enabling preventive measures versus countermeasures. SBA allows a virtual life cycle product validation before production. Thus SBA can significantly reduce overall program risk and cost. The model used in the SBA, the Artemis Capabilities-Based Architecture Based Model (ACBAM), is described and usage explained.
